The Cumulative CAMAG Bibliography Service CCBS contains all abstracts of CBS issues beginning with CBS 51. The database is updated after the publication of every other CBS edition. Currently the Cumulative CAMAG Bibliography Service includes more than 11'000 abstracts of publications between 1983 and today. With the online version you can perform your own detailed TLC/HPTLC literature search:

  • Full text search: Enter a keyword, e.g. an author's name, a substance, a technique, a reagent or a term and see all related publications
  • Browse and search by CBS classification: Select one of the 38 CBS classification categories where you want to search by a keyword
  • Keyword register: select an initial character and browse associated keywords
  • Search by CBS edition: Select a CBS edition and find all related publications

      102 092
      SIMULTANEOUS HPTLC ESTIMATION OF AMBROXOL HCl AND CETIRIZINE HCl IN THEIR COMBINED DOSE TABLET
      S. Bagade*, N. Gowekar, A. Kasture (*University Dept. of Pharmaceutical Sciences, R. T. M. Nagpur University Campus, Nagpur 440033, India, sbbagade@rediffmail.com)

      Asian J. Chem. 19(2), 1487-1493 (2007). TLC of ambroxol HCl and cetirizine HCl on silica gel with methanol - ethyl acetate - toluene - ammonia 3:10:12:1. Quantitative determination by absorbance measurement at 231 nm. The hRf value of ambroxol HCl was 78 and of cetirizine HCl 40. The calibration curve response was observed between 4 and 10 µg for ambroxol HCl and 0.4 and 0.8 µg for cetirizine HCl via peak height and area. The percent drug estimated for ambroxol HCl and cetirizine HCl from marketed formulation was 99.9, 100.2 by height and 100.8, 99.1 by area respectively. Recovery of ambroxol HCl via peak height and via peak area was 102.7 and 100.0 % respectively, and for cetirizine HCl 99.3 and 98.1 %.

      102 137
      Simultaneous determination of mirtazapine and its three main impurities by a high performance thin layer chromatography/densitometry method
      T.S. REDDY, P.S. DEVI* (*Analytical Chemistry Division, Indian Institute of Chemical Technology, Tarnaka Hyderabad 500007, India; sitadevi@iictuet.org)

      J. Liq. Chromatogr. Relat. Technol. 31, 1204-1212 (2008). HPTLC of mirtazapine (1,2,3,4,10,14b-hexahydro-2-methyl-pyrazino[2,3-c][2-benzazepine]), and three impurities (2-(4-methyl-2-phenyl-piperazin-1-yl)nicotinic acid, [2-(4-methyl-2-phenyl-piperazinyl)-pyridin-3-yl]methanol, and 2-chloronicotinic acid on silica gel with toluene - acetone - methanol 6:2:2 with chamber saturation. Quantitative determination by absorbance measurement at 285 nm. The limit of detection and quantification for mirtazapine was 22 and 75 ng/spot, respectively.

      76 210
      Identification of methylated metabolites of inorganic arsenic by thin-layer chromatography
      M. STYBLO*, M. DELNOMDEDIEU, M.F. HUGHES, D.J. THOMAS, (*Curriculum in Toxicol., Univ. North Carolina, Chapel Hill, NC, USA)

      J. Chromatogr. 668, 21-29 (1995). TLC of 73As-radiolabelled title compounds in aqueous solution, rat liver cytosol and urine of mice on cellulose with 1) methanol - NH3 8:2, 2) isopropanol - acetic acid - water 20:2:5. Detection by autoradiography. Oxidation of samples by hydrogen peroxide improved the separation and quantification of monomethylarsonate in both biological matrices.
